Paralegal Hourly Wage Breakdown
| Percentile | Hourly Rate | Per 8hr Shift |
|---|---|---|
| Entry Level (P10) | $25.12 | $200.98 |
| Lower Range (P25) | $28.35 | $226.81 |
| Median (P50) | $36.21 | $289.66 |
| Upper Range (P75) | $45.30 | $362.37 |
| Top Earners (P90) | $56.12 | $448.98 |

Hourly Rate Trajectory for Paralegals in Gloucester Township (2019–2027)
2019–2025: actual BLS OEWS data for this metro area. 2026+: CAGR 3.51% projection.
| Year | Hourly Rate |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$28.78/hr | Actual |
| 2020 | $29.43/hr | Actual |
| 2021 | $31.28/hr | Actual |
| 2022 | $32.93/hr | Actual |
| 2023 | $33.91/hr | Actual |
| 2024 | $37.82/hr | Actual |
| 2025 | $34.98/hr | Actual |
| 2026(current) | $36.21/hr | Estimated |
| 2027 | $37.48/hr | Projected |
Based on 7 years of BLS OEWS metropolitan area data, the median hourly rate for paralegals in Gloucester Township grew 21.6% from $28.78/hr (2019) to $34.98/hr (2025). At a 3.51% projected growth rate, hourly pay is expected to reach $37.48/hr by 2027. Part-time and per-diem paralegals can use this multi-year trend to benchmark future contract negotiations.

Working as an Hourly Paralegal in Gloucester Township
For a part-time paralegal working 24 hours a week, the annual take-home is significant, but the total differs markedly when compared to full-time positions. While full-time paralegals will have a more extensive annual salary, part-time professionals can maintain a desirable work-life balance, particularly when engaged in per diem or freelance roles. Contract paralegals in Gloucester Township may find billing rates ranging from $25 to $50 per hour, based on their experience and specialization. Paralegals in e-discovery can expect an even wider range, pulling in $30 to $60 hourly. Freelance corporate paralegals might command anywhere from $40 to $75 per hour, depending on the project's complexity, while those involved in trial preparation could earn between $50 and $90 per hour when litigation heats up. As employers range from BigLaw firms to non-profits, compensation can vary widely, often reflecting the trade-off between higher pay without benefits versus employee stability and health insurance.
